the 360's in my 76' F32 run fine till you get to the dock. Then, they like to die at idle. Anybody got any ideas??

There could be many reasons for this with the simple ones being too low an idle speed when in gear and engine warm--- improper idle fuel mixture---- if you have the carter afb type carbs , adjust the mixture screws counter clock wise maybe 1/4 to 3/4 turns to richen up the mixture ( maybe too lean after carb warms and choke plate full open)--- remember to turn them in lightly to the stop to get your current setting and write it down , then go from there---- try that first and see what happens , more info would be good etc--- Mike
